Inclusion criteria
Inclusion criteria: Adult patients 18 years of age or older who have been on ventilatory management in the ICU for at least 48 hours and are considered for weaning from the ventilator (SBT can be cleared).
Exclusion criteria
Exclusion criteria: Patients who cannot maintain airway patency (impaired consciousness, weak cough reflex, high airway secretions, positive cufflink test, etc.), severely obese (BMI>35 kg/m2), patients with chest trauma or other difficulties in EIT monitoring, post esophageal surgery, etc.
Design outcomes
Primary
| Measure | Time frame |
|---|---|
| work of breathing (pressure time product with esophageal pressure), transpulmonary pressure (inspiratory transpulmonary pressure, delta transpulmonary pressure), oxygenation after extubation, end-expiratory lung volume (end-expiratory impedance), ventilation distribution (tidal impedance variation), and pendelluft phenomenon. | — |
Secondary
| Measure | Time frame |
|---|---|
| Successful weaning from ventilator Respiratory failure and reintubation rate at 72 hours after extubation Respiratory complications (pneumonia, hypoxemia, upper airway obstruction, bronchospasm, etc.) for 5 days after extubation or until ICU discharge | — |
